About this Course

One of the key cancer informatics challenges is dealing with and managing the explosion of large data from multiple sources that are often too large to work with on typical personal computers. This course is designed to help researchers and investigators to understand the basics of computing and to familiarize them with various computing options to ultimately help guide their decisions on the topic. What You'll Learn

  • Understand basic computer and shared computing resources operation
  • Recognize benefits and drawbacks of available computing options
  • Evaluate key factors for effective computing decisions
